Hi Kinnard,

Coming to Noisebridge is a good time to meet people.  If you want to make 
sure you'll meet members who will sponsor what you want to do, a tuesday 
night at 8PM is the weekly meeting and many people will be there.

I suggest making a general announcement at the meeting and see if you can 
meet someone who wants to sponsor you and teach you about the space.

If you are already a user of noisebridge I recommend you go for Associate 
Membership status (by getting four sponsors to sign your wiki page) and 
then you can host your class at noisebridge without anyone else needing to 
sponsor you or the class.
